Description
Meta is an abstract game and in Italian it means goal. The term is also used in rugby to indicate the objective of a team: to make a meta. As in rugby, a player's goal is to bring a piece to a meta square on the opposite side. The board is a grid of 64 squares, plus 4 meta squares in the 4 corners. Each player has 8 pieces and 2 arrow-pieces. These 2, like head-prop in rugby, are powerful, but only pieces can make a meta!
